Migrate from webpack to vite (#37002)
Replace webpack with Vite 8 as the frontend bundler. Frontend build is around 3-4 times faster than before. Will work on all platforms including riscv64 (via wasm). `iife.js` is a classic render-blocking script in `<head>` (handles web components/early DOM setup). `index.js` is loaded as a `type="module"` script in the footer. All other JS chunks are also module scripts (supported in all browsers since 2018). Entry filenames are content-hashed (e.g. `index.C6Z2MRVQ.js`) and resolved at runtime via the Vite manifest, eliminating the `?v=` cache busting (which was unreliable in some scenarios like vscode dev build).
